Revolving around the first recording of Sir James MacMillan's Kiss on Wood for viola and piano arranged and performed by Rachel Yonan, this album explores the polarity of light and darkness. Minimalist composer Arvo Pa"rt's beloved Fratres and Spiegeli'm Spiegel bookend the program. The concept of light infuses these pieces with their intense clarity and search for transcendent meaning. Fratres (Brotherhood) evokes the struggle between good and evil with it's contrasting voices. Spiegel i'm Spiegel (Mirrorin Mirror) is pure and stable as it sonically imagines the infinite reflection between two mirrors. Pa"rt's deeply spiritual music links to MacMillan's devotional Kiss on Wood which invites the listener into a place of stillness and silence as it reaches for an essenceof meaning beyond words. MacMillan sounds out the darknessof loss, yet finds delicate rays of hope to fill the long spaces.Paired with these intense yet static twenty-first century works are Schumann's miniature character pieces Ma"rchenbilder (Fairytale Pictures) that use an emotional palette ranging from bright and playful to deeply melancholic.
